Understanding the Core Mechanics of the Game
At its heart, the game is a test of risk management. Players control a chicken attempting to traverse a busy road. Each step the chicken takes increases the potential payout, but also the probability of encountering an obstacle – usually represented by oncoming traffic. The objective is to strategically advance, accumulating points with each successful step, and then cash out before the inevitable happens. The longer you wait, the bigger the reward… but so too is the danger. This foundational premise creates a compelling internal struggle for players, demanding constant evaluation of risk versus reward. Mastering this balance is crucial for achieving high scores and climbing the leaderboards.
The simplicity of the controls is another key element of its appeal. Typically, the game uses a single tap or swipe mechanic to control the chicken's movement. This allows for intuitive gameplay on mobile devices, making it perfect for quick sessions on the go. While the controls are simple, the strategic depth is surprisingly significant. Players must anticipate the movements of obstacles, time their steps perfectly, and develop a feel for when to take a risk and when to play it safe. Success isn’t just about luck; it’s about developing a calculated strategy.

The Role of Chance and the Illusion of Control
While strategic thinking plays a significant role, there's also an element of chance involved. The unpredictable nature of the obstacles adds a layer of excitement and ensures that no two playthroughs are exactly alike. However, even in the face of randomness, players often perceive a greater degree of control than actually exists. This “illusion of control” is a common cognitive bias that can contribute to the game's addictiveness. Players may believe that their skills and strategies are solely responsible for their success, even when luck plays a significant role. This perception reinforces their engagement and motivates them to continue playing.
Understanding this interplay between skill and chance is crucial for maintaining a healthy perspective. While it's important to develop effective strategies, it’s also essential to acknowledge the role of luck and avoid becoming overly invested in the outcome. A balanced approach can enhance your enjoyment of the game and prevent frustration when things don't go your way.
